DePaul University offers over 30 different club sports. Clubs are open to current DePaul University students of any skill level and offer the opportunity to learn an activity or compete with other colleges throughout the state, region, and country.

It's easy to get involved! Choose any club sport from our directory below and contact the club or stop by a practice. Another option is to stop by the Club Sports Office in the Ray Meyer Fitness and Recreation Center or contact James Alexander  Assistant Director - Club Sports for more information.

Before you can participate in a club sport you need to complete a waiver.

Start a New Club

Review the process for starting a new club sport at DePaul University.

  • Contact the Office of Student Involvement about becoming an officially registered student organization.
  • Contact James Alexander, Assistant Director-Club Sports , about your plans.
  • Complete the process required by the Office of Student Involvement to become an official registered student organization:
    • Complete the application process on DeHub.
    • Attach completed constitution
    • List three elected officers and a faculty advisor
    • Add eight members to the roster
    • Attend mandatory workshops (registration and SAF-B) required by the Office of Student Involvement.

Once the group is approved by the Office of Student Involvement, schedule a final meeting with James Alexander, the Assistant Director-Club Sports.
